The Federal Government holds an expiring lease which includes approximately 41,000 gross square feet of existing Class A office, exhibition, or other special purpose space, in or near downtown Las Vegas, NV. The National Nuclear Security Administration (NNSA) may be interested in considering alternative space if economically advantageous. NNSA will consider the relocation costs (i.e.,moving, alterations, and telecommunications), when deciding whether it should relocate or pursue a sole source. The ideal space would fit building specifications in compliance with all federal, state, and local ordinances; and would house public-facing customers such as a public reading room, the Nuclear Testing Archives, and a museum. Ample parking for public visitors is required. A five-year firm term lease with five one-year renewal options is intended. Space must be ready for occupancy by June 1, 2023.
